I heard that after B.pharma, going to M.pharma (mainly in pharmacology-Clinical Research) is waste of time and money. Better join any
clinical course (3-6months or 1year), get experienced, and search for a job. Is it true? are these clinical courses really helpful?
-
1 Answer
-
Hi, going for higher educatiion is never a waste especially M.Pharm. Even if you wish to take up clinical research, your further growth in this field will laregly depand upon your M.Parm qualification apart from the experience. To enter clinical research field you can pursue M.Pharm in any stream along with a short training program in Clinical Research
